跨学科的综合学习
Spark实践视频网站通常不仅仅局限于单一学科的教学,而是通过跨学科的综合学习,帮助学习者建立更全面的知识体系。例如,在学习Spark数据处理时,系统可能会结合机器学习、数据可视化、统计分析等多个学科的知识,提供综合性的学习内容。这种跨学科的综合学习,不仅拓宽了学习者的知识面,还提升了其综合应用能力。
2内存?计算模型
Spark采用内存计算模型,将数据加载到内存中进行计算,这大大提升了数据处理的速度。Spark的核心数据结构包括:
RDD(ResilientDistributedDataset):Spark的最基本的数据结构,支持离线和在线计算,具有高可靠性和容错性。DataFrame:一种更高级的数据结构,类似于关系数据库中的表,提供了更多的?SQL功能。DataSet:一种与RDD类似的数据结构,但支持类型安全的操作,更适合使用Java和Scala编程语言。
操作步骤:
配置SparkStreaming:在Spark配置文件中设置Streaming参数,如批处理间隔等。创建StreamingContext:使用StreamingContext创建DStream对象,从数据源读取数据。数据处理:对DStream进行转换和操作,如过滤、映射、聚合等。
持久化和存储:将处理后的数据持?久化存储,如写入HDFS、数据库等。
如何最大化利用视频学习
1.制定学习计划:在开始学习之前,制定一个详细的学习计划。明确每天或每周的学习目标,并按照计划进行。这样可以确保你的学习不会变得杂乱无章。
2.保持规律性:学习编程需要持续性和规律性。每天抽出固定时间学习,不仅能帮助你更好地记忆和理解,还能养成良好的学习习惯。
3.积极参与讨论:在学习过程中,积极参与网站上的讨论和交流。与其他学习者分享心得,解决疑惑,不仅能加深理解,还能获得更多的学习资源和建议。
4.实践应用:学习新知识后,立即尝试在自己的项目中应用。这样可以加深理解,并能够发现和解决实际问题,提升编?程技能。
5.持续更新:编程技术在不断发展,保持对新技术和新工具的关注,并不断更新自己的?知识库,是提升编程水平的重要途径。
实践中的常见问题及解决方案
在实际应用Spark时,球速可能会遇到各种问题。中国Spark实践网站提供了详细的解决方案:
内存?不足:教程介绍了如何通过调整Spark配置参数和优化算法,解决内存不足的问题。任务失败:教程提供了调试和排查Spark任务失败?的方法,包括日志分析和错误处理。性能优化:教程展示了如何通过调优Spark配置、优化算法和使用分布式计算来提高Spark任务的性能。
如何选择合适的视频内容
1.评估自己的水平:在选择视频内容时,首先要评估自己的编?程水平。如果你是一个基础学习者,可以从基础的入门视频开始,逐步提升难度。如果你已经有一定基础,可以选择一些高级的?项目视频,挑战自己。
2.关注项目实战:选择那些有实际项目背景的视频,这样的内容不仅能帮?助你掌握理论知识,还能通过实战项目提升你的编程能力。
3.多样化学习:不要局限于一个编程?语言或者一个领域,多样化的学习能帮助你发现自己的兴趣所在,并4.关注实用性:选择那些能够直接应用到实际工作中的视频。比如,如果你希望在数据分析领域有所突破,选择那些涉及数据处理、分析与可视化的视频会更有帮助。
5.查看评价和反馈:在选择视频时,可以参?考其他学习者的评价和反馈。这些评价能帮助你判断视频的质量和实用性,从而做出更明智的选择。
用户互动与社区建设
未来,国内sparksparkling视频将更加注重用户互动和社区建设。通过建立和维护活跃的?社区,创作者可以与粉丝进行更深层次的交流,了解观众的真实需求和意见,从而不断改进和创新。社区内的互动和交流将成为视频平台的重要组成部分,增强观众的粘性和忠诚度。
校对:李四端(buzDe0HjqpQ3K6bY6uJKaO81ta0QzLgz)


